Frequently Asked Questions About St. Louis Junkyards

Are there junkyards in St. Louis that specialize in certain types of cars, like older American models?expand_more

Some St. Louis junkyards tend to accumulate specific makes or eras of vehicles based on local demand and common breakdowns. It's best to call ahead and ask if they have the type of car you're looking for, especially if you're after parts for a classic American car.

Do St. Louis junkyards near the Mississippi River flood?expand_more

Flooding is a concern in some areas of St. Louis, especially near the river. However, most established junkyards have taken precautions, such as elevating parts or moving valuable inventory during flood warnings. It's wise to confirm their operating status during periods of heavy rain.

What's the best way to get to junkyards on the outskirts of St. Louis if I don't have a car?expand_more

Public transportation within St. Louis city is fairly extensive, but reaching junkyards in the outer suburbs like Fenton or Hazelwood can be difficult without a vehicle. Consider ride-sharing services or renting a car for the day if you need to visit yards outside the immediate city limits.

Are prices negotiable at junkyards in St. Louis?expand_more

Yes, prices are often negotiable at St. Louis junkyards, especially if you're buying multiple parts or paying in cash. Don't hesitate to haggle a bit, particularly if you know the part's normal market value or if it's a slow-moving item.

Illustrative parts prices — not local yard quotes

Common PartAvg. PriceCore Charge
Alternator$52$13
Starter Motor$42$11
Battery (Standard)$32$13
Door Mirror (Power)$27
Radiator$60$20
Engine (4-Cyl)$510$100
Auto Transmission$414$85

*Regional averages from published self-service yard price lists (2024–2025, inflation-adjusted). Not St. Louis-specific — individual yards set their own prices, so call ahead to confirm.
